Heat Pump Installation Questions
What is a heat pump? A heat pump is a system that provides both heating and cooling by transferring heat between the indoors and outdoors.
How does a heat pump work during cold weather? It extracts heat from the outside air, even in cold temperatures, to warm the interior space efficiently.
What types of properties are suitable for heat pump installation? Heat pumps can be installed in a variety of properties, including homes and small commercial buildings, with appropriate sizing and setup.
What should property owners consider before installing a heat pump? It’s important to evaluate the property's insulation, existing ductwork, and overall heating and cooling needs to ensure optimal performance.
